Transaction ab63d112715068f4fb1642e538fa8157c79f6d2d7a376ad54b4e902920ddab8e

1 Input
2 Outputs
  • ab63d112715068f4fb1642e538fa8157c79f6d2d7a376ad54b4e902920ddab8e:0
  • value  527002
    address  bc1qwl0uayfnnlze8ghrj0vfr9707qmnnq9laufgxa
  • ab63d112715068f4fb1642e538fa8157c79f6d2d7a376ad54b4e902920ddab8e:1
  • value  4329
    address  3FpmjJU3RXmuHMsX7SM6Aghm8xg2gyKy6p